So, what is a cylinder, and how do we calculate its surface area? A cylinder is a three-dimensional shape with two parallel and circular bases connected by a curved lateral surface. To calculate the surface area of a cylinder, we need to consider the area of the two bases and the area of the curved lateral surface. The formula for the surface area of a cylinder is:
